1. 程式人生 > >太極鏈平臺九大應用功能

太極鏈平臺九大應用功能

應用功能是指太極鏈平臺為進行使用者身份管理、實現上層應用所需的基礎功能元件,應用功能是在核心技術元件基礎上,提供了針對區塊鏈應用場景的基礎管理功能,一方面其允許通過使用智慧合約的方式制定商業規則以管理交易,靈活操作鏈上資產,並輔以賬戶體系使區塊鏈生態與現實商業社會更加緊密地銜接;另一方面,對於聯盟鏈和專有鏈,通過應用功能中的身份認證、私鑰保護等手段,強化成員管理,實現可信交易和防偽朔源。同時,通過設定節點許可權,與現有商業規則中的監督體系保持一致。

1. 身份認證

太極鏈採取匿名身份認證體系,對線上線下的身份匹配無強制要求。

2. 賬戶設計

太極鏈採用了餘額賬戶機制。由於太極鏈是以智慧合約為主要功能,而智慧合約中要處理UTXO的狀態相當困難,相比之下,餘額設計更便於程式實現。

3. 私鑰保護

太極鏈採取的模式為:無人操作的挖礦/記賬節點上不儲存私鑰,隨同這些節點部署的智慧合約也不使用私鑰,所有的私鑰部署於“端”,由使用者本地儲存。

4.支援智慧合約

太極鏈可實現“圖靈完備(一切可計算的問題都能計算,程式邏輯自洽)”的智慧合約功能,採用合約和共識相連。主要運用Solidity合約開發語言,具備圖靈完備的特性。

5. 監管相關功能

太極鏈因其有公有鏈特徵,監管可隨時接入,但由於身份匿名性,監管接入的意義不大。

6. 特權機制

目前,特權機制主要有兩類:一是暫停、回滾或者取消交易;二是改正資料。太極鏈不支援特權機制,一旦發生異常,無法通過特權機制進行回滾、取消交易或改正資料的處理。

7. 吞吐量

目前,太極鏈網路受限於CPU單執行緒效能。網路已達到每秒25次交易(在某種優化條件下),通過優化可能會提高到50TPS或100TPS。

8. 確認時間

當前太極鏈協議取決於節點根據在計算上開銷更高的工作量證明(PoW)演算法選擇用於最長鏈的下一個區塊。這種方法區塊鏈每12秒左右提交一個新的區塊,確認時間也是在12秒左右。

9. 可用性

太極鏈採用的工作量證明機制(PoW)提供了較高的靈活性和可用性。因為每個節點都獨立構造區塊而不需要其他節點的參與,節點可以隨時加入或者退出網路,即使全網只剩一個節點,網路還是可以繼續工作,但相應地它也失去了交易的最終性(保證交易不可撤銷)。